Understanding Bean to Cup Machines
Bean to cup machines are automated coffee machine that grind whole coffee beans right before developing. The Best Bean To Cup Coffee Machine maximizes taste retention, scents, and necessary oils, providing an exceptional taste experience compared to pre-ground coffee. Developed for convenience, these machines can produce a range of coffee styles, consisting of espresso, cappuccinos, and lattes.
Benefits of Bean to Cup Machines
- Freshness: Grinding the beans right away before developing preserves the coffee's natural flavors. Fresh coffee grounds release important oils that add to a richer taste.
- Convenience: Many bean to cup machines are created for easy to use operation. With the push of a button, users can enjoy their preferred coffee drinks without intricate developing methods.
- Versatility: Most machines offer customizable settings, making it possible for users to change grind size, coffee strength, and beverage size according to individual preferences.
- Consistency: With automated grinding and brewing processes, these machines provide consistent brewing results, ensuring a quality cup every time.
- Cost-effective: While the in advance financial investment might be higher, the long-lasting savings from preventing coffee shop gos to can make these machines economically favorable.

Upkeep Tips for Bean to Cup Machines
To make sure a long life-span for a bean to cup machine, regular upkeep is essential. Here are some useful ideas:
- Daily Cleaning: Clean the developing system and water tank every day to avoid residue accumulation.
- Usage Fresh Beans: Store coffee beans in an airtight container to maintain freshness. Prevent buying excessively large amounts.
- Descale Regularly: Follow the manufacturer's instructions for descaling to avoid mineral accumulation.
- Inspect for Wear and Tear: Regularly examine parts for indications of wear, particularly the grinder and the water system.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
What is the cost variety for bean to cup machines?
The cost of bean to cup machines can differ significantly. Fundamental designs start around ₤ 300, while high-end models can surpass ₤ 2,000. The best option will depend on functions wanted and budget constraints.
Are bean to cup machines tough to clean?
Many bean to cup machines feature functions developed for simple cleansing. Numerous designs have automatic cleaning procedures, and removable parts streamline upkeep.
Can bean to cup machines make iced coffee?
While beans to cup machines mostly focus on hot drinks, some models have features that enable users to prepare cold beverages by changing developing temperature level and strength.
Do bean to cup machines require special coffee beans?
There are no particular bean constraints; however, it is normally advised to utilize high-quality coffee beans for ideal flavor.
For how long do bean to cup machines last?
With proper maintenance, an excellent quality bean to cup machine can last anywhere from 5 to 10 years, making it a worthwhile investment for coffee lovers.
